EMSL Analytical, Inc., a leader in environmental and occupational laboratory testing, is highlighting the health risks of occupational wood dust exposure in construction, woodworking, and related industries. Millions of workers face daily exposure to airborne wood particles, which can cause serious respiratory and long-term health issues if not properly controlled.

Wood dust is classified as a known human carcinogen by the International Agency for Research on Cancer (IARC). Short-term exposure may cause coughing, nasal irritation, eye discomfort, and allergic reactions, while prolonged or repeated exposure can lead to chronic respiratory conditions such as asthma, sinusitis, and, in severe cases, nasal cancer. High-risk industries include construction, carpentry, furniture manufacturing, and cabinetry, where cutting, sanding, and milling generate airborne dust.
